New York Love Stories: Vol. 2
by S.L. Scott
New York Love Stories Volume 2 is a collection of two full novels that can be read as standalones or is enhanced when you read from beginning to end.
Head Over Feels
It Started with a Kiss
This group of family and friends join together in both books as different characters navigate dating and finding love in these modern romances.
Our favorite tropes such as friends to lovers, billionaires, enemies to lovers, contemporary romance, and opposites attract, this collection of bestselling books will have you falling hard as you binge read this swoony and romantic series.

S.L. Scott's New York Love Stories: Vol. 2 is a delightful dive into the complexities and joys of modern romance set against the vibrant backdrop of New York City. This collection, which includes two full novels, Head Over Feels and It Started with a Kiss, offers readers a chance to immerse themselves in the intertwined lives of a group of friends and family as they navigate the unpredictable waters of love and relationships.
One of the standout features of this collection is its ability to blend popular romance tropes with fresh storytelling. The inclusion of beloved themes such as friends to lovers, billionaires, enemies to lovers, and opposites attract ensures that readers will find something familiar yet exciting. Scott's skillful weaving of these elements into her narratives allows for a reading experience that is both comforting and exhilarating.
The first novel, Head Over Feels, introduces us to a world where emotions run high and love is often found in the most unexpected places. The characters are well-crafted, each with their own unique quirks and personalities that make them relatable and endearing. The protagonist's journey from friendship to romance is handled with a deft touch, allowing for a slow burn that feels both natural and satisfying. Scott's ability to capture the nuances of a developing relationship is truly commendable, making this story a standout in the collection.
It Started with a Kiss, the second novel, takes a slightly different approach by exploring the dynamics of an enemies to lovers relationship. The tension between the main characters is palpable, and Scott expertly balances the push and pull of their interactions. The transformation from animosity to affection is handled with care, ensuring that the progression feels authentic and earned. The chemistry between the characters is electric, making their eventual union all the more rewarding.
Character development is a strong suit in Scott's writing. Each character is given ample space to grow and evolve, with their personal journeys intricately woven into the larger narrative. The supporting cast is equally well-developed, adding depth and richness to the story. The interconnectedness of the characters across both novels adds an additional layer of enjoyment, as readers are able to see familiar faces and witness their growth over time.
Scott's portrayal of New York City as a vibrant and dynamic setting adds another dimension to the stories. The city becomes a character in its own right, with its bustling streets and iconic landmarks serving as the perfect backdrop for the unfolding romances. The author's love for the city is evident in her detailed descriptions, which bring the setting to life and immerse readers in the world she has created.
In terms of themes, New York Love Stories: Vol. 2 explores the idea of love in its many forms. From the initial spark of attraction to the deepening of emotional connections, Scott delves into the complexities of relationships with sensitivity and insight. The novels also touch on themes of self-discovery and personal growth, as characters learn to navigate their own desires and insecurities in the pursuit of happiness.
Comparatively, Scott's work stands out in the contemporary romance genre for its ability to balance lighthearted romance with deeper emotional exploration. While authors like Christina Lauren and Sally Thorne also excel in crafting engaging romantic narratives, Scott's unique voice and attention to character detail set her apart. Her ability to create a sense of community among her characters adds a warmth and familiarity that is often missing in other works.
Overall, New York Love Stories: Vol. 2 is a captivating collection that will appeal to fans of contemporary romance and those looking for a heartfelt exploration of love and relationships. S.L. Scott's engaging storytelling, well-rounded characters, and vibrant setting make this a must-read for anyone seeking a romantic escape. Whether you're a longtime fan of Scott's work or new to her writing, this collection is sure to leave you swooning and eager for more.
